9/11 Fund to Start Cutting Future Payments to Victims
The compensation fund for victims of 9/11 is running out of money and will cut future payments by 50 to 70 percent, officials announced Friday. Hot Cars Act Introduced on Capitol Hill
Legislation announced Wednesday would require car companies to install alarms to remind drivers to check the back seats of cars once they are turned off.
